Material Integrity and Durability


The visible materials imply a galvanized metal construction, which is a significant upgrade over standard, untreated steel fittings. Galvanization provides a protective zinc coating that acts as a sacrificial layer, preventing rust and corrosion. This is crucial for components exposed to harsh environments, moisture, and road salts, common in automotive and industrial settings. Cheap fittings corrode quickly. They fail under pressure.

Unlike many generic fittings that might use inferior alloys or thin plating, these appear to be robust. The galvanization process bonds zinc to the steel, creating a durable barrier against environmental degradation. This means the fittings will maintain their structural integrity and appearance longer, reducing the frequency of replacement. Longevity is key. It saves time and money. Versatility in Application and Design


This kit's inclusion of straight, 45-degree, and 90-degree curved mouth fittings in multiple metric sizes (M6, M8, M10) provides exceptional versatility. This range covers a vast array of machinery and vehicle types, from cars and motorcycles to heavy trucks and industrial equipment. Different angles are often necessary. Access can be tricky.

The various angles are not merely aesthetic choices; they are functional necessities. In many applications, a straight zerk might be impossible to access with a grease gun due to obstructions. A 45-degree or 90-degree fitting allows for easier access, ensuring that lubrication can be performed regularly without dismantling components or struggling with awkward angles. This saves significant time and effort during routine maintenance. Accessibility is key. It simplifies the process. Installation and Maintenance Considerations


Proper installation of grease fittings is crucial for their performance and longevity. While the fittings themselves are designed for durability, incorrect installation can compromise their integrity and lead to leaks. The threads must be clean. Torque matters.

Before installation, the receiving port should be thoroughly cleaned to remove any debris or old sealant that could interfere with the new fitting's seal. Applying a small amount of thread sealant or PTFE tape (though often not strictly necessary for zerks, it can provide an extra layer of security against leaks) can further enhance the seal, especially in high-vibration environments. The fitting should be threaded in by hand first to ensure proper alignment, then tightened with a wrench to the manufacturer's recommended torque specifications. Over-tightening can strip threads. Under-tightening causes leaks. This careful approach prevents damage to both the fitting and the equipment, ensuring a long-lasting, leak-free connection. It's a simple step, but vital.

Regular inspection of installed grease zerks is also part of good maintenance practice. Check for signs of corrosion, damage, or leakage. A damaged zerk can prevent grease from entering the bearing, leading to premature failure. Replacing a faulty zerk is a quick and inexpensive fix that can prevent much more expensive repairs down the line. Don't ignore small issues. They become big problems. The Plumber's Perspective on Leak Prevention


From a master plumber's standpoint, any fitting that handles fluid or semi-fluid material, like grease, must be absolutely leak-proof. The principles of sealing and pressure integrity are universal, whether it's water, gas, or lubricant. A leak is a failure. It's unacceptable.

The galvanized finish on these fittings is a good start, as it protects the exterior from corrosion that could eventually compromise the fitting's structure or make it difficult to attach a grease gun. However, the internal design, particularly the ball check valve, is what truly prevents grease from flowing back out once injected. This internal mechanism must be robust and precisely engineered to hold pressure. A weak spring or poorly seated ball will lead to immediate leakage. This is where quality counts. It's the heart of the fitting.

Furthermore, the compatibility with standard grease guns is essential. The head of the zerk must be dimensionally accurate to ensure a tight connection with the grease gun coupler, preventing blow-by during lubrication. If the coupler doesn't seat properly, grease will squirt out, making a mess and failing to reach the intended lubrication point. This is a common frustration. It wastes product.
